Ferris ISX800Z Series Specifications

General IconGeneral
EngineVanguard™ 810, Vanguard™ EFI, Yanmar® Diesel
Engine Displacement810cc
Cutting Width61 inches
TransmissionHydro-Gear® ZT-4400™ Transaxles
Fuel Capacity12 gal / 45.4 L
Weight1343 lb / 609.1 kg - 1446 lb / 655.8 kg
Spindle MaterialCast Iron
Deck TypeFabricated
Turning RadiusZero
Speed10 mph
